ch2软件计划.ppt

《实用软件工程》陆惠恩编著 第2章 第2章 软件计划 问题定义及可行性研究 制订项目开发计划 需求分析的任务 需求分析步骤 面向数据流的需求分析 面向对象的需求分析                                 可行性研究报告 可行性研究报告的编写目的是: 说明该软件开发项目的实现在技术、经济和社会条件方面的可行性; 评述为了合理地达到开发目标而可能选择的各种方案; 说明并论证所选定的方案 ——GB8567-88《计算机软件产品开发文档编制指南》 可行性分析报告的内容组织 (1)陈述开发目的、要求和限制条件,表达可行性分析的前提条件 (2)对现有系统的描述,进而阐述系统开发的意义和必要性 “现有系统”,是指当前实际使用的一个反映领域业务流程的可操作环境。这个系统,既可能是一个计算机系统,也可能是一个非计算机系统,甚至是一个人工工作的业务流程 (3)提出若干新系统的建议方案,并依次进行技术、经济和社会可行性分析 现有系统当初的建立,是当时环境条件制约下完成的;新系统的开发,应该以获得新的条件和环境资源作为前提的 在对系统进行可行性分析的时候,不必为了系统的顶层分析和设计活动,深入到目前可能还无法到达的系统底层,也无须考虑系统进入每个处理的细节。(避免进入实际上的开发过程,节约项目前期人工、时间、成本等资源的消耗) (4)在比较选择多个可选方案的基础上,得出可

文档评论(0)

1亿VIP精品文档

相关文档